#fdc289 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fdc289 is composed of 99.2% red, 76.1%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 45.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 29.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 76.5%. #fdc289 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fb8513.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#fdc289 color description : Soft orange.
#fdc289 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fdc289 has RGB values of R:253, G:194,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.46,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16630409.

Shades and Tints of #fdc289
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110900 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dc289
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c3c0 is the less saturated color, while #fdc289 is the most saturated one.
